Arsenal had a chance to sell and negotiate a deal three weeks ago but try to crowbar a deal for the last second. The club is not in unison between Wenger and the rest of the front office. A situation which reflects so badly now on this club. Arsenal is a mess. The handling of this whole situation is terrible; absolutely no idea what they're doing right now. When you finally decide to sell Sanchez, check first that the guy who you want, wants to join your club. The timeline of this transfer is so difficult to understand. It goes from...
1. Wanting Lamar while not selling Sanchez.
2. Only wanting to pay as high as £40 million for Lemar
3. Finally decide to sell Alexis, in the last freakin day.
4. Gadizis agrees to sell him to Man City
5. Then offers £90 million for Lemar
6. Lemar declines the move.
7. The whole deal falls apart.
8. Now you have a frustrated player who doesn't want to be there.
